首页
/ Mozilla sccache项目PyPI版本更新问题解析

Mozilla sccache项目PyPI版本更新问题解析

2025-06-03 00:09:13作者:沈韬淼Beryl

在软件开发过程中,构建缓存工具对于提升开发效率至关重要。Mozilla的sccache作为一个分布式编译缓存工具,能够显著减少编译时间。然而,近期社区发现PyPI(Python包索引)上托管的sccache版本存在滞后问题,这引发了开发者们的关注。

PyPI上托管的sccache版本停留在0.7.4,而该版本存在一些严重问题。社区成员迅速响应,指出需要尽快更新至0.7.6或更高版本以解决这些问题。这一情况凸显了开源项目中版本同步的重要性。

经过社区协作,项目维护者messense迅速采取行动,将PyPI上的sccache版本更新至0.7.7。值得注意的是,由于技术原因,新版本暂时移除了Linux i686架构的wheel包,这是因为在CentOS 7 Docker容器中编译该架构时遇到了困难。

这一事件展示了开源社区的高效协作机制:

  1. 问题发现:社区成员及时识别出版本滞后问题
  2. 权限管理:项目维护者之间进行必要的权限交接
  3. 技术决策:针对编译问题做出临时架构移除的合理决策
  4. 快速响应:在短时间内完成版本更新

对于开发者而言,这一事件提醒我们:

  • 应定期检查项目依赖的版本状态
  • 了解不同版本间的兼容性和问题修复情况
  • 关注开源项目的更新动态

sccache作为重要的构建加速工具,其版本更新的及时性直接影响着开发者的工作效率。这次版本更新不仅解决了已知问题,也体现了开源社区在维护关键基础设施方面的责任感和效率。开发者现在可以通过PyPI获取最新的0.7.7版本,享受更稳定的构建缓存体验。

登录后查看全文
热门项目推荐
相关项目推荐